#b9bfcc color RGB value is (185,191,204). #b9bfcc color name is Custom Color color.
#b9bfcc hex color red value is 185, green value is 191 and the blue value of its RGB is 204.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#b9bfcc hue: 0.61, saturation: 0.16 and the lightness value of b9bfcc is 0.76.
The process color (four color CMYK) of #b9bfcc color hex is 0.09, 0.06, 0.00, 0.20. Web safe color of #b9bfcc is #cccccc. Color #b9bfcc contains mainly BLUE color.

About #B9BFCC Custom Color
#B9BFCC (Custom Color) is a blue-based color with RGB values of 185, 191, 204. This color belongs to the blue color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.
When working with #b9bfcc,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.
For web development, #b9bfcc can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#b9bfcc), RGB (rgb(185, 191, 204)), HSL (hsl(221, 16%, 76%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cccccc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
